In an effort to improve customer service at Rhode Island T. F. Green International Airport, the Rhode Island Airport Corporation (RIAC) has relocated its primary taxi pickup area for quick and easy access for arriving travelers. The new primary taxi pickup area, accessed via the crosswalk across from the lower level arrivals area roadway immediately outside the terminal, is just a short walk from the Arrivals/Baggage Claim area of the airport. The relocated taxi pickup area was opened during the holiday travel season and has been welcomed by taxi companies and customers alike.

In accordance with Transportation Security Administration regulations, taxi companies and drivers utilizing the new primary pickup area have completed required documentation and background checks to become ‘trusted agents’ in order to receive a badge to enter this area of the parking lot. Arriving passengers gain closer airport access to taxi service while taxi companies benefit from reduced parking rates and increased customer patronage.

About Rhode Island T. F. Green International Airport: A convenient and low-cost gateway to New England, Rhode Island T. F. Green International Airport (PVD) has a large catchment area with 7.5 million residents within 90 minutes of the airport. It attracts passengers from nearby Massachusetts and eastern Connecticut. PVD is located just outside of Providence, Rhode Island. Well known for ease of traveler access, affordable parking, and faster security lines, Rhode Island T. F. Green International Airport was named as one of USA Today’s Readers’ Choice Best Small Airports” for 2021 as well as “Top Five” in Travel + Leisure’s “World’s Best 2020” Awards for Top Domestic Airports. Rhode Island T. F. Green International Airport was most recently named 4th “Best Airport” in the U.S. in the Condé Nast Traveler Readers’ Choice Awards.
